Alignment: LG, NG, CG, LE Major Geographical Features Great Plateau: During the Sundering, a large portion of central Teruno was violently thrust upward. A plateau was formed running primarily East and West that dissects the continent in two parts. Also during the Sundering, a section of Eastern Teruno collapsed and fell beneath the waves. This divided the Great Plateau in two pieces. The cliff walls of the Plateau rising up from the land are anywhere from 1 to 4 miles in height. The only part of the land unaffected was the area around Lycondons Tower. Although none know for sure, it is theories that the power and magic of the gate protected it. Straights of Sorrow: During the Sundering, after the raise of the Great Plateau, I section of the land collapsed and sunk beneath the ocean. This divided the continent into East and West and left a string of islands. Important Sites There are view areas that dont fall under the rulership of the countries of Teruno. They are as follows: Lycondon's Tower: Lycondon built his tower at the site of the great world gate that brought the new races to Philenos. In exchange for being left alone and the occasional offering of the dead criminals of Teruno, Lycondon and the generations of descendants watch over the gate and protect the world from the things that emerge from it. It is rumored that Lycondon discovered the secret of using the gate and that secret has been passed down through those that swear to protect the gate, but none know for sure. Towers of Light and Dark: When the god and goddess that brought the new races to Philenos left the mortal plain, they left behind 2 towers as a symbol of their power and a reminder to the people. That told the people that when they were ready for the knowledge contained in the towers, they would open. The actual contents of the tower remain a secret, even to the gods and goddess that have come after the great two. Their are many ruins scattered across Philenos. No one is quite sure what civilization existed before, but there is evidence that at one time a great society flourished here.

Pator is the first country formed by the new races upon arrival. Eventually most of the non-human races left to form their own nations. Today it is primarily human. It is well known for its honest, hard working people. It has a very competent military and provides vegetables and grain for a majority of the know world. As a result, wealth is abundant and even the lowest serfs are often treated better here then anywhere else in Philenos. Life and Society Each of the major cities of Pator is controlled by one of the noble houses. When the king dies, the leaders of each house decide the next king. Someone in line to be the house leader, is not eligible to be the king. This insures that no noble is of lesser importance then any other as even those who can never lead their house can still be called up to be king. Smaller towns are general ruled by these would be kings. They are general under control of the house controlling the nearest city. For these reasons, Town Lords and Ladies tend to be very justice, profit, and productivity oriented as they are all vying for the spot as the next king/queen. Many towns are ruled with the philosophy that a happy serf is a product serf. On the other side of that, Crime of any kind if treated very harshly. Major Geographical Features Pator has a very mild climate. There are actually two growing seasons per year. Most of Pator is gentle rolling farmland and well kept forests. 3 Tunnels: The only way thru the Great Plateau is by 3 man made tunnels. Technically they lead thru the dwarven kingdom but most of the dwarven towns are either above the tunnels in the plateau or below the tunnels deep in the earth. Without a competent guide, it would be impossible to find the way to the dwarven kingdom through them. Great Falls: Two great waterfalls cascade off of the Great Plateau into Pator. The eastern falls are somewhat polluted from the mines and processing areas of the Dwarven kingdom on the plateau. The Western Falls however, is always pure, crystal clear water and is used by most of the noble house of Pator. It seems to be enchanted and is resistant to mixture with poisons. Mist Isle: the Mist Isle is located at the base of the western most waterfall coming off of the Great Plateau. It is so close to the base of the falls that it is shrouded in mist most of the time. Many residents of nearby Draknaa and Zorvain claim to see lights and hear strange noises coming from the island. The unexplored ruins of a great city dot the island. They remain unexplored as no one that journeys to the island and returns will talk about what they have seen. Historians theorize that the site was a place of great magical power before the sundering that raised the Great Plateau. Southern Great Cliff: The southern side of the Great Plateau is the northern border of Pator. This massive cliff wall blocks most of the cold northern winds and is the main reason for its mild climate. Important Sites Pator is one of the most domesticated areas in all of Philenos. Bomas: (Metropolis 34,975) Bomas is the home of the oldest college of magic in all of Philenos. Although not the largest, it is the oldest and most selective. It has a fine tradition of turning out responsible scholars. Most of the noble houses in Pator send their members who show promise to the college here. Lately Bomas has been hit very hard by raiders from the Pirate Islands. The college has been enlisted to aid the local noble house in repelling the raiders. Although the city does have a thriving harbor and rich agricultural trade, a majority of its business revolves around supporting the college. When the college is in session, it has roughly 4000 students and faculty.
Mazon Capital: Population: Government: Monarchy Religions:Mostly gods/goddess associated with nature and arts Imports: Exports:Lumber Mazon was formed by the elves a couple of centuries after The Arrival. They broke from the other races to form a country more in tune with Nature. Today, it is still primarily elven, although other nature oriented races have begun to live with the elves in harmony. Although they are pacifist for the most part, the elves do not let themselves be pushed around and have successfully defended their new homeland from those that thought it would be easy to take over. Life and Society There is only one city in Mazon and it is the capital. Other major settlements are mostly set up for the elves to trade amongst themselves and with others. Queen Illiania rules from the Capital as she has for 300 years. Talk is spreading that she will soon step down and let one of her children take over. Progression to the throne has been passed down in this fashion since Mazon was founded. Each of the elven noble house are in basically in charge of an industry. For example, the Loriana family controls all of the organized lumber industry in Mazon. Officially, no family is considered more powerful then any other.
